By looking at the uneditable_textarea class, it seems the problem is not font-size:small (which doesn't exist for this class), but rather because it has font-family:monospace. monospace can have a different font size than "normal" text, explaining the difference. Probably it's unappropriate to define font-family here, i.e. it should only be used by the bz_comment_text class.
